Method

Preparation

  1. 1

    Prepare the Vegetables

    Wash and trim the green beans, cutting off the ends. Peel and dice the potatoes and carrots into bite-sized pieces. Chop the onion finely, and dice the tomatoes. Mince the garlic cloves.

  2. 2

    Chop the Herbs

    Rinse the fresh parsley under cold water, shake off excess moisture, and chop it coarsely.

Cooking

  1. 3

    Sauté the Onions and Garlic

    In a large pot, heat the olive oil over medium heat. Add the chopped onion and minced garlic. Sauté until the onion is translucent, about 5 minutes.

  2. 4

    Add the Vegetables

    Add the green beans, diced potatoes, and carrots to the pot. Stir well to combine with the onion and garlic mixture.

  3. 5

    Incorporate the Tomatoes

    Add the diced tomatoes, dried oregano, salt, and black pepper to the pot. Stir thoroughly to ensure all ingredients are well mixed.

  4. 6

    Simmer

    Pour in the water, cover the pot, and bring to a simmer. Reduce heat to low and let it cook for about 30 minutes, stirring occasionally until the vegetables are tender.

  5. 7

    Finish with Herbs

    Once the vegetables are tender, stir in the chopped parsley. Adjust the seasoning with additional salt and pepper if needed.
